The highest authority in the nation is the US Constitution. It forms the basis of the government, determines which of the laws are legal, and protects the rights of the American people.

Supreme authority within the borders of a state or nation is sovereign authority. It comes from the concept that the king, or sovereign, had supreme authority within the kingdom.
